您所在的位置:首页 - 科普 - 正文科普

dcs如何编程

政谦
政谦 05-20 【科普】 929人已围观

摘要**标题:DCS电机编程指南**DCS(数字控制系统)电机编程是现代工业自动化领域中的重要组成部分,它为各种应用提供了高度可编程和灵活性的控制。本指南将为您介绍DCS电机编程的基础知识、常见编程语言和

DCS电机编程指南

DCS(数字控制系统)电机编程是现代工业自动化领域中的重要组成部分,它为各种应用提供了高度可编程和灵活性的控制。本指南将为您介绍DCS电机编程的基础知识、常见编程语言和技术,并提供一些建议,帮助您更好地理解和应用DCS电机编程。

1. DCS电机编程基础

1.1 了解DCS系统

DCS系统是一种分布式控制系统,通常由多个控制器组成,用于监控和控制工业过程中的设备和机器。每个控制器负责不同的任务,并通过网络进行通信和协调。

1.2 电机控制原理

DCS电机编程的基础是理解电机的控制原理。这包括控制电机的速度、转向、加速度等参数,以及与其他设备或传感器的接口和通信。

2. 常见的DCS电机编程语言

2.1 Ladder Logic

梯形图是一种常见的用于编程PLC(可编程逻辑控制器)的语言。它使用图形化的元件(如继电器、计数器、定时器等)来描述控制逻辑。对于简单的电机控制任务,梯形图是一种直观且易于理解的编程语言。

2.2 Function Block Diagram (FBD)

功能块图是另一种图形化的编程语言,它使用函数块来表示控制逻辑。FBD在某些情况下比梯形图更适合复杂的控制任务,因为它可以更容易地实现模块化和重用。

2.3 Structured Text (ST)

结构化文本是一种类似于传统编程语言(如C语言)的文本编程语言。它提供了更大的灵活性和控制,适用于复杂的算法和逻辑控制。

3. DCS电机编程技术

3.1 PID控制

PID(比例积分微分)控制是一种常用的控制技术,用于调节电机的速度和位置。通过调节PID参数,可以实现稳定和精确的控制。

3.2 脉冲宽度调制(PWM)

PWM是一种调节电机速度的技术,通过改变电机输入的脉冲宽度来控制电机的平均功率。这种技术通常用于调节直流电机的速度。

3.3 位置编码器反馈

位置编码器可以提供电机当前位置的准确反馈,从而实现闭环控制。通过结合位置编码器反馈和PID控制,可以实现精确的位置控制。

4. DCS电机编程的指导建议

4.1 熟悉硬件和软件

在进行DCS电机编程之前,确保对使用的硬件和软件平台有足够的了解。熟悉控制器的功能和编程环境可以帮助您更高效地开发和调试程序。

4.2 进行仿真和测试

在实际应用之前,进行仿真和测试是至关重要的。通过使用仿真工具或虚拟环境,可以在实际应用之前验证程序的正确性和稳定性。

4.3 持续学习和改进

DCS技术不断发展和演进,因此持续学习和改进是必不可少的。定期参加培训课程、研讨会和行业会议,以保持对最新技术和趋势的了解,并不断提升自己的技能水平。

结论

DCS电机编程是现代工业自动化中的重要组成部分,掌握好电机编程的基础知识、常见编程语言和技术,以及遵循指导建议,将有助于您更好地应用DCS电机编程,实现工业过程的高效控制和优化。

https://ksdln.com/

Tags: dcs控制电动机图 dcs编程讲解视频 编程电机是什么 dcs电机控制块有哪些功能 电机编程控制系统

最近发表

icp沪ICP备2023034348号-27
取消
微信二维码
支付宝二维码

目录[+]